An antelope raised it's head, black orbs outlined with white short hairs. It had heard somthing, and paused for a moment before lowering it's head again to continue it's meal. The meal that would be it's last. Luka stared out with wide alert eyes as she waited for the ooved beast to venture closer, closer to it's death trap. She kept low to the ground, her white tummy (which was leaner than usual) sinking into the soft earth. She felt her muscles twitch under anxiety, until the right moment happened. SHe sprang out in a hurried rush, jaws open as she reached out to trip the already terrified antelope. She scrambled after it as it evaded her claws, till it bumped into another misfortuned female antelope. Sinking her teeth into flesh, she held on as the antelope gave it's final death cry, before Luka sat up onto her haunches, breathing hard for a few moments. They were getting faster, the little devils. She wasn't made for long running, and it was harder without another working with you. Taking the dead creature back into her jaws, she dragged it to the shade of where she had hidden, and began to rip at the fresh kill.

The Female antelope who had bolted was tackled to the ground by Kronos, slammed into the ground with a couple of cracks, 2 in the ribs and one in the neck. It was quick, silent and easy as he looked to see where it had been grazing. Oh yeah, he saw the white lioness, the one who triggered the panic of which he took advantage of. Looked like he was seeking and exploiting all opportunities he can see.
"Thanks," he called over, his foreign accent practically dripping from the word as he started his meal with the first cut across the dead creature's chest.
He was right about him cracking 2 ribs from where he had pushed his paws in and he had started eating. Hunger wasn't a huge factor of his life but when it did strike, he was nearly senseless in his kill. He looked over to the white Lioness, never seeing such colour before on a predetor before again, focusing on his food.

Kronos let out a low growl at the mention of humans.
"Humans..." he started, "They were the reason why my pack and my forefathers travelled so far south. If not our journey, I wouldn't be alive and my ancestors would be dead."
He completely despised the humans. Then again, why wouldn't he? His pack died because of them, he was a lone survivor because of them, the humans were the cause of all the problems in his life. Now, he couldn't even sleep peacefully, getting up swiftly at the slightest foreign sound.
"They are cruel savages who should be put to death," he said with a snarl.
He had looked up to see the things which seemed to be made to burden the senses and his hatred deepened. The weaklings wanted to rule over all the world and they need the help of such idiotic things. Then he shook his head. All these murderous thoughts may turn him onto the path of which he was warned again from walking.
"Well, I'm here alone now, my pack died out because of the damned journey," Kronos said with a sharp exhale, "It must of been hell not knowing whom were sworn by your side."
